- What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
Upon initial contact, a guide containing our pricing and services will be provided. At that time, a rough estimate will be submitted based on the type / complexity of the project and any additional options chosen. Once interest is established in hiring EDS Drafting Services, a Service Agreement will be assembled for review. Upon approval, a signature and deposit will be required in order to schedule the project. Next step would be for us to schedule to come out to the site where construction is to take place. At that time measurements, photos and documentation will take place as well as a detailed discussion of the project. Once all of the information is received, the drawings begin. You will be sent, via email, some rough plans along the way allowing us to perform revisions where necessary. When we receive your final approval, you will get a digital copy and / or a hard copy to submit for a permit.
